How to fill out specialty medication prior authorization

How to fill out specialty medication prior authorization:
01
Obtain the necessary forms: Contact your healthcare provider or insurance company to request the specialty medication prior authorization form. It may also be available on their website or through their customer service.
02
Fill out personal information: Start by entering your personal details such as your name, address, date of birth, and insurance information. Make sure to provide accurate and up-to-date information to avoid any delays or complications.
03
Provide healthcare provider information: Include the name, contact information, and credentials of the healthcare provider prescribing the specialty medication. This may be your primary care physician, specialist, or a healthcare professional specifically trained in managing specialty medications.
04
Describe the medication: Clearly indicate the specific medication for which you are seeking prior authorization. Include the medication name, dosage, frequency, and any other relevant details. It may be helpful to attach a prescription or supporting documentation from your healthcare provider.
05
Explain the medical necessity: In this section, provide a detailed explanation of why the medication is medically necessary for your condition or treatment. Include the diagnosis, previous treatments that have been attempted, and the potential benefits of the specialty medication.
06
Attach supporting documents: Gather any supporting documents that can strengthen your case for the prior authorization. This may include medical records, test results, clinical notes, or letters of medical necessity from your healthcare provider.
07
Follow submission instructions: Carefully review the instructions provided on the prior authorization form or guidelines from your insurance company. Ensure that you have completed all the required sections and included any necessary attachments. Follow the specified submission method, whether it's by mail, fax, or electronically.
Who needs specialty medication prior authorization?
Specialty medication prior authorization may be required for individuals who are prescribed high-cost and complex medications used to treat rare or chronic conditions. Insurance companies often use prior authorization as a way to manage costs and ensure appropriate usage of these medications.
Common examples of conditions that may require specialty medication prior authorization include:
01
Rheumatoid arthritis
02
Multiple sclerosis
03
Cancer
04
Hepatitis C
05
HIV/AIDS
06
Crohn's disease
07
Psoriasis
08
Mental health disorders requiring specialized medications
It's important to check with your insurance provider to understand their specific criteria for requiring specialty medication prior authorization.

What is specialty medication prior authorization?
Specialty medication prior authorization is a process where a healthcare provider must get approval from a health insurance company before a specific specialty medication can be prescribed or filled.
Who is required to file specialty medication prior authorization?
Healthcare providers such as doctors, nurse practitioners, and pharmacists are required to file specialty medication prior authorization.
How to fill out specialty medication prior authorization?
To fill out specialty medication prior authorization, healthcare providers need to complete a form provided by the health insurance company, including information about the patient's diagnosis, medication prescribed, and medical necessity.
What is the purpose of specialty medication prior authorization?
The purpose of specialty medication prior authorization is to ensure that the prescribed medication is appropriate for the patient's condition and is covered by the insurance plan.
What information must be reported on specialty medication prior authorization?
Information such as patient's diagnosis, medication prescribed, medical necessity, prescriber's information, and insurance information must be reported on specialty medication prior authorization.
